The MA15KP48CAE3 belongs to the category of transient voltage suppressor (TVS) diodes.
It is used to protect sensitive electronic components from voltage transients induced by lightning, electrostatic discharge (ESD), and other transient voltage events.
The MA15KP48CAE3 is available in a DO-201AD package.
The essence of the MA15KP48CAE3 lies in its ability to divert excessive current away from sensitive components, thereby safeguarding them from damage due to voltage spikes.
It is typically packaged in reels or trays and is available in varying quantities based on customer requirements.
The MA15KP48CAE3 has a standard DO-201AD package with two leads. The anode is connected to one lead, while the cathode is connected to the other lead.
When a transient voltage event occurs, the MA15KP48CAE3 conducts excess current away from the protected circuit, limiting the voltage across it to a safe level. This action prevents damage to the sensitive components.
The MA15KP48CAE3 is commonly used in: - Telecommunication equipment - Industrial control systems - Automotive electronics - Power supplies - Consumer electronics
